Season 1
Episode: 1x01 | Airdate: Oct 9, 1977
Julia and Maria are anxious to start production on their first deodorant commercial – however, their boss has requested they have the handsome young actors audition in their underwear.
Episode: 1x02 | Airdate: Oct 16, 1977
A prospective client, Leyland Bartlett, a wood magnate, imbibes too heavily on a dinner date with Julia and passes out on her sofa-bed, leading to wild rumors that put Julia in an awkward position with her employer.
Episode: 1x03 | Airdate: Oct 23, 1977
Maria falls for a tall, handsome man and interprets his distant attitude as a sign he really cares. Then suddenly, a surprise gift puts everything into a different light.
Episode: 1x04 | Airdate: Oct 30, 1977
Maria is visited by her father who is fighting with her mother and it falls on Maria and Julia to show the two older people how to get along.
Episode: 1x05 | Airdate: Nov 6, 1977
A blackout hits New York City leaving Julia stranded on the thirty-third floor with a resourceful insurance salesman who romances her by candlelight.
Episode: 1x06 | Airdate: Nov 13, 1977
Julia's next door neighbor, a Shakespearian actor named Keith Keith, leaves his cat and his plants in Julia's care, leading to unexpected complications with the law.
Episode: 1x07 | Airdate: Nov 27, 1977
Toni decides to bring in professional help from a psychologist when she notices the office tension has become unbearable. The staff undergoes group therapy, leading to total honesty and they air their grievances with one another which results in a new set of problems.
Episode: 1x08 | Airdate: Dec 4, 1977
When the painters disrupt Maria's apartment, Julia insists she move in with her and it becomes a real test of their friendship.
Episode: 1x09 | Airdate: Dec 11, 1977
Julia's landlady raises her rent and when Julia complains to Maria that her salary can't stand the increase, she discovers Maria's weekly income is great than hers.
Episode: 1x10 | Airdate: Jan 8, 1978
Julia meets a blind radio announcer named "Jack the Bat" and falls for him, only to discover that his perception of things is clearer than she suspected.
Episode: 1x11 | Airdate: Jan 22, 1978
A new client, of the Bedford Ad Agency, known as Mr. Sunshine, invites Maria, Julia and Eddie to his establishment in Palm Springs. They are delighted and plan to attend, then they find out it's a nudist camp.
Episode: 1x12 | Airdate: Jan 29, 1978
Maria's Uncle Vito and his tart tongued assistant will never be the same after the girls moonlight for vacation money at his donut shop.
Episode: 1x13 | Airdate: Feb 5, 1978
Julia takes her ketchup commercial to a famous writer, Alexander Butler, author of The Naked Summer, who is going to endorse the product and discovers his interests lie beyond a normal business relationship.
Episode: 1x14 | Airdate: Feb 19, 1978
Julia's fun loving, ex-sorority sister, Marilyn no longer having a husband, comes for a visit and pursues Julia's boyfriend.
Episode: 1x15 | Airdate: Feb 26, 1978
When Toni joins a panel of business women on the David Susskind Show, she ends up being fired from the Bedford Ad Agency.
Episode: 1x16 | Airdate: Mar 5, 1978
Eddie lies to two out-of-town friends that his girlfriend is April Baxter and that he is living with her. When they show up and want to meet her, he panics and pleads with April to help against her strong objections.
Episode: 1x17 | Airdate: Mar 12, 1978
When Julia comes down with stomach pains following a night out with a young doctor, she ends up in a hospital emergency room as his patient.
Episode: 1x18 | Airdate: Apr 2, 1978
Maria discovers an old high school flame still burns bright and before she knows it she's agreed to marry Skip Mazarelli from her neighborhood in Brooklyn. Then she discovers he has two children from a previous marriage. Part 1 of 2.
Episode: 1x19 | Airdate: Apr 9, 1978
The engagement party at Maria's turns sour when she and Skip argue over the prospect of Maria continuing as a career woman when he feels she should stay home and take care of the house and kids. Part 2 of 2.
Episode: 1x20 | Airdate: Apr 16, 1978
Bedford Ad Agency celebrates its 25th anniversary and the staff joins in an office talent show.
Episode: 1x21 | Airdate: Apr 23, 1978
When red roses arrive at the ad agency addressed to "the most beautiful girl in the world," no one is quite sure for whom they are intended.
Episode: 1x22 | Airdate: Apr 30, 1978
Chuck Randall, also known as "Mr. Meat," fast-talks the girls into purchasing a freezer plus meat rental plan. He winds up in a small claims court, however, when the girls discover the freezer's real contents.
